<div dir="ltr">When transferring large arrays (especially when using collective operations and complex types), problems like SIGSEGV or ABORT may appear due to integer overflow. I offer a patch to solve some situations. I am also attaching a small test that simulates one of the problems.<br><div><span style="font-size:14.6667px">Regards, Alexander Melnikov.</span><br></div></div>